Output 25da587e827994eab09e525a4d8ef5a5eb3291a5644fd3dfcd7a0ff6a20030e0:0

value
1833696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d73957fa5d96708af7c1f47682ae4436afd5d198 OP_EQUAL
address
3MK1u6TZiMfPkP8rmPMJHC4MGaoHuKtT4V
transaction
25da587e827994eab09e525a4d8ef5a5eb3291a5644fd3dfcd7a0ff6a20030e0
spent
true